R3 classification, one-component, cementitious, high build concrete repair and reprofiling low-density mortar.
Sika® MonoTop®-615 is a one-component, cement-based, polymer-modified, high-build repair and reprofiling mortar, meeting the requirements of Class R3 of EN 1504-3.

Third-party product certification | Drinking Water Certificate: Water Regulations Advisory Scheme Ltd (WRAS) Approval Number: 2305561. |
Layer thickness | Guidance for specification option: Insert requirements, minimum 3 mm; maximum 50 mm (~30 mm overhead). |
Colour | Grey. |
Density | Fresh mortar density ~1.65 kg/L. Hard mortar density after 28 days: ~1.89 kg/L. |
Chloride Ion content | To EN 1015-17, <0.009% (soluble). |
Compressive strength | To EN 12190, ~35 N/mm² after 28 days. Guidance for specification option: After one day: ~12 N/mm²; after seven days: ~30 N/mm². |
Modulus of elasticity | To EN 13412, in compression: ~16 kN/mm². |
Flexural strength | To EN 12190, ~ 7.0 N/mm² (after 28 days). |
Tensile Adhesion | To EN 1542, ≥2 N/mm². |
Shrinkage | To EN 12617-4, restrained shrinkage/ expansion: ~2.5 N/mm². |
Capillary absorption | To EN 13057, 0.11 kg/(m².√h). |
Carbonation resistance | To EN 13295, dk ≤ control concrete (MC (0.45)). |
Reaction to fire | To EN 1504-3 cl 5.5, EuroClass A1. |
Standards | Conforms to the requirements of EN 1504-3 R3 Classification. |
